WebJan 24, 2012 · To get proper floating point number there is a variable called scale. Scale means the precision of floating point, how many digit after the point. By default the scale is 0, that means it is integer. Above example can be solved with scale to get correct output as shown below. $ echo "scale=2; 2/5" bc Output: .40 cochlear nerve deficiency icd 10

WebDivision; because all numbers in awk are floating-point numbers, the result is not rounded to an integer—‘3 / 4’ has the value 0.75. (It is a common mistake, especially for C programmers, to forget that all numbers in awk are floating point, and that division of integer-looking constants produces a real number, not an integer.) x % y WebMar 30, 2024 · Bash doesn’t support floating-point arithmetic.
